Consumer Law

Consumer law is the field of law that protects the health, safety, and economic interests of consumers. The rights of consumers are guaranteed by consumer laws. These laws enable consumers to purchase healthy and safe products, access correct information, receive compensation or a refund. Consumer law contains legal measures, lawsuits, and compensation to protect the rights of consumers. It also includes the follow-up of consumer complaints, control of product safety, making misleading or non-misleading advertisements, etc. Consumer law aims to enable consumers to make healthy, safe, and correct decisions based on correct information.
